Foundation Overview

Based in Lone Wolf, OK, Elmer Tepe Lone Wolf Foundation has awarded 55 grants totaling $250,000 to organizations in Oklahoma. Individual grants range from $500 to $11,000, with a median award of $3,000.

Form 990-PF Research Tips
  • Review Part XV for detailed grant recipient information and funding purposes
  • Check Part I for total assets, annual giving amounts, and payout requirements
  • Examine Part VIII for key personnel compensation and board structure
  • Look for trends across multiple years to understand giving patterns
